Output d755aaa4ebaae96d5758c34d134e48a57b47fd5a84a996c85e4232cf9b86f872:0

value
2682466
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68a859f4202dcaccfcba372757afa9cacb848907 OP_EQUAL
address
3BEPskdsn25Z4yg27AmAnyqzLxQoTrJr2N
transaction
d755aaa4ebaae96d5758c34d134e48a57b47fd5a84a996c85e4232cf9b86f872
spent
true